Age: 18 years and above.
Individuals of all genders can participate in the study.
Aleast 12 years of formal education.
Scoring the cut-off of 76 or higher in PPCS.
Currently not seeking professional help for Problematic pornography use.
Working knowledge of the English language.
Individuals who gave informed consent to participate in the study.
Score of 75 (out of 126) or below in PPCS.
Individuals with severe mental disorders (schizophrenia and bipolar disorder) or severe neurological conditions.
Individuals who refused to give informed consent to participate in the study.
